KDE released [the second beta of the KDE Platform, Workspaces and Applications 4.11](http://www.kde.org/announcements/announce-4.11-beta2.php), and after the necessary time for the OBS to build packages from the released tarballs, packages are available for openSUSE 12.3 and openSUSE Factory. Like the previous beta, they are available through the [KDE:Distro:Factory](http://en.opensuse.org/KDE_repositories#Factory_aka._KDF_.28KDE_SC_4.10.29) repository. 4.11.x is is targeted for inclusion in the upcoming openSUSE 13.1.
So far 4.11 has been pretty stable for me, but you should never forget these packages are for **testing and bug reporting purposes**: don't use them on production systems. In case you find a bug:
* if it is a _packaging bug, _report it to [Novell's bugzilla](http://bugzilla.novell.com);
* if it is a bug _in the software_, report it [directly upstream to KDE](http://bugs.kde.org).
Don't forget there is [a specific area on the KDE forums](http://forum.kde.org/viewforum.php?f=260) to discuss this beta release.
